Looks like you have a very solid setup there. It is good to see that you haven't skimped on the fuel management at all.
It looks like it is running very, very lean for a turbo setup with the super high compression an R has. You should be shooting for less than 12:1 and it doesn't even dip below that on the AFR chart. Maybe I am just on crack....

h: